It is the second largest underground cistern in Istanbul (after the Basilica Cistern) but the oldest one, built by Constantine the Great who founded (Constantinople) in 330 AD with 212 columns.
After seeing the Basilica Cistern pay a visit to the Cistern of Philoxenos. Slightly smaller but deeper than the Basilica Cistern, it hosts weddings and events.
The Cistern of Philoxenos, is a man-made subterranean reservoir in Istanbul, situated between the Forum of Constantine and the Hippodrome of Constantinople in the Sultanahmet dsitrict.
